Class certification has been granted in this antitrust lawsuit against Supervalu and C&S Wholesale Grocers which involves Activity Based Sell (“ABS”) fees charged for wholesale grocery products between December 31, 2004 and September 13, 2008. Your legal rights may be affected by this class action litigation. The plaintiffs in this lawsuit allege that the defendants agreed not to compete for wholesale grocery customers in certain states and that these customers incurred damages as a result. Supervalu and C&S deny these allegations and believe their conduct has been lawful at all times, and the Court has not decided whether Supervalu or C&S did anything wrong. The lawsuit is proceeding as a class action on behalf of five Classes of customers located in Illinois, Indiana, Iowa, Michigan, Minnesota, Ohio, or Wisconsin that paid fees based on Supervalu’s Activity Based Sell (“ABS”) pricing system on wholesale grocery products which they purchased: in all four Supervalu ABS product categories (grocery, dairy, frozen, and general merchandise/health and beauty care); directly from Supervalu’s Distribution Centers in Champaign, IL, Hopkins, MN, Green Bay, WI, or Pleasant Prairie, WI; from December 31, 2004 through September 13, 2008. To return to the main menu, press 2. Option 3 – What are my options if I am a Class Member? If you wish to remain in any of the Classes, you do not need to take any action at this time. There has not been a settlement in this case. If there is a recovery in the case in the future, you will be notified as to how and when to file a claim. If you remain in a Class, You will be bound by the outcome of this lawsuit. If you wish to exclude yourself from this lawsuit, you must send a letter by mail to the Notice Administrator that includes the following: Your name, address, telephone number and signature; All trade names or business names and addresses used by you or your business; and Your request to be excluded from the Classes in In re Wholesale Grocery Products Antitrust Litigation, Civil No. 09-md-02090-ADM-TNL. You must mail your exclusion request, postmarked no later than July 1, 2017, to: Wholesale Grocery Products Antitrust Litigation, ATTN: EXCLUSIONS, c/o JND Class Action Administration, PO Box 6878, Broomfield, CO 80021.
